TAP enhances digital systems with CHAMP API integration

TAP Air Cargo has implemented CHAMP’s application programming interface (API) with its computer system, enabling it to “improve its internal business processes, tracking, and synchronisation of its supply chain”.

CHAMP said that as a result of “special circumstances”, the solution was implemented in less than a week.

Nicholas Xenocostas, vice president of commercial and customer engagement at CHAMP Cargosystems, commented: “APIs are a powerful tool that can take any airline to the next level of communication. TAP Air Cargo’s transition towards total communication will open many new possibilities in streamlining its business.”

Bernardo Nunes, senior manager of cargo and mail, business development, at TAP Air Portugal, added: “CHAMP’s APIs work well and efficiently. Leveraging CHAMP’s API provided us and our clients with much additional value. We see many more opportunities for value gains in future.”

TAP Air Cargo said it also uses a variety of CHAMP services across its cargo management applications, supply chain integration, regulatory compliance and community marketplace services.
